Identifying and Preventing Bugs and Errors

Testing code helps to uncover bugs, glitches, and errors that may exist within the software. By systematically running different test scenarios, developers can pinpoint and address issues that might otherwise remain hidden. This proactive approach prevents potential malfunctions and ensures that the software functions as intended, providing a smooth user experience.

Enhancing Software Reliability and Stability

Thorough testing contributes to enhancing the reliability and stability of software. It validates the functionality of different components, ensuring they perform accurately under various conditions. This process minimizes the likelihood of system failures, crashes, or unexpected behavior, thus instilling confidence in the software’s performance.

Improving Software Security

Testing code plays a crucial role in identifying vulnerabilities and security loopholes within the software. Security testing helps in fortifying the system against potential threats, such as unauthorized access, data breaches, or cyber attacks. By addressing these vulnerabilities early in the development cycle, developers can strengthen the software’s security posture.

Saving Time and Resources

While it might seem like testing adds an extra step to the development process, it ultimately saves time and resources in the long run. Detecting and fixing issues during the development phase is far more cost-effective than addressing them after the software has been deployed. It reduces the need for extensive debugging and rework, ensuring a more efficient development lifecycle.

Enhancing User Experience

High-quality software resulting from rigorous testing translates into an improved user experience. Software that functions reliably and seamlessly without unexpected errors or interruptions leads to greater user satisfaction. A positive user experience fosters user retention, positive reviews, and word-of-mouth recommendations, contributing to the software’s success.

Meeting Requirements and Expectations

Testing ensures that the software meets the specified requirements and fulfills user expectations. By validating that the software functions according to defined criteria and performs the intended tasks accurately, testing helps in meeting client needs and delivering a product that aligns with stakeholder expectations.
